Abstract: 7-Arylhydrazono[1,2,4]triazolo[3,4-b][1,3,4]thiadiazines 4 were synthesized from the reactions of 4-amino-5-phenyl-4H-[1,2,4]triazole-3-thiol 2 and 2-(2-naphthyl)-2-oxoethanehydrazonoyl bromides 1 and their acid dissociation constants pK and pK*, in the ground and excited states, respectively, were determined. Both pK and pK* constants were correlated by Hammett equation. The pK and the spectral data presented indicate that the title compounds exist predominantly in the hydrazone tautomeric form.
